Grace Therapeutics Inc.

NASDAQ: GRCE · Real-Time Price · USD
3.17
0.09 (2.92%)
At close: Aug 15, 2025, 10:59 AM

Grace Therapeutics Fail-to-Deliver

Total FTD Shares
439
Below Average
FTD / Avg. Volume
0.73%
Low Impact
1-Year Change
n/a

FTD Chart

As of Jul 3, 2025, Grace Therapeutics Inc. has 439 shares failed to deliver, representing 0.73% of the average daily volume of 59,880 shares. Over the past year, the monthly average FTD is 2,788 shares, with the current level 84% below the historical average, indicating low settlement pressure. The weighted FTD ratio below 1% suggests normal market making activity with adequate liquidity.

FTD History

Date Price FTD Shares % Change
Jul 03, 2025 3.13 439 -83.38%
Jun 30, 2025 2.97 2.64K +552.35%
May 30, 2025 2.77 405 -74.92%
Apr 29, 2025 2.56 1.61K +101.88%
Mar 31, 2025 2.28 800 -77.46%
Feb 27, 2025 3.02 3.55K -70.89%
Jan 31, 2025 3.3 12.2K +25306.25%
Dec 27, 2024 3.71 48 -97.70%
Nov 26, 2024 3.35 2.09K +1053.04%
Oct 31, 2024 3.2 181 n/a